Brighton Complete Historic Deal for Croatian Star Luka Vuskovic from Tottenham in Record Transfer
Brighton have completed a major transfer by signing young Croatian defender Luka Vuskovic from Tottenham for a club-record fee, strengthening their squad with one of Europe’s brightest talents.

Brighton have completed one of the biggest deals of the current transfer window by signing Croatian young defender Luka Vuskovic from Tottenham Hotspur in a historic transfer worth £46 million. 🔥
The deal represents a club-record signing for Brighton, with the defender agreeing to a five-year contract with an option for an additional season, reflecting the club’s strong belief in his abilities and future potential. ⭐
The signing of Vuskovic follows Brighton’s long-term strategy of identifying and developing young talents, as the club has become one of England’s leading teams in promoting emerging players and turning them into international stars. 🌍⚽
🛡️ Tottenham Agree to Sell Croatian Talent
Tottenham rejected two previous offers for Vuskovic last month before reaching a final agreement with Brighton for £46 million.
The total value of the transfer could rise to £50 million if additional performance-related clauses are achieved in the future. 💰🔥
Vuskovic joined Tottenham in 2025 from Croatian club Hajduk Split after the English side reached an agreement with him two years earlier as part of their plan to secure top European talents at a young age.
🌟 Impressive Bundesliga Season Behind Transfer
After joining Tottenham, Vuskovic moved on loan to German club Hamburg, where he experienced a major development stage.
The Croatian defender played 30 matches last season and scored six goals in the Bundesliga, an impressive record for a centre-back. ⚽🔥
He won the Young Player of the Season award and earned a place in the league’s Team of the Season after his outstanding performances attracted attention from several European clubs.
🎙️ Brighton Coach Explains Vuskovic Signing
Brighton manager Fabian Hurzeler confirmed that the club had closely followed Luka Vuskovic’s progress before deciding to complete the transfer.
Hurzeler said the player showed last season that he can perform at a very high level and that Brighton want to help him continue developing within the club’s environment.
The coach added that Vuskovic remains a young player who will need time to adapt to the demands of Brighton and the Premier League, but the club believes he has the confidence and personality needed to succeed. ⭐
🔄 Vuskovic Replaces Van Hecke
Luka Vuskovic is expected to replace Dutch defender Jan Paul van Hecke in Brighton’s squad after the latter joined Tottenham in a long-term deal worth £52 million.
Vuskovic possesses several qualities that made him a target for major clubs, including physical strength, defensive awareness, and the ability to build attacks from the back.
Brighton hope he can continue developing and become one of the Premier League’s top defenders in the coming years. 🏆
🇭🇷 Vuskovic Establishes Himself with Croatia
Internationally, Luka Vuskovic has earned six appearances for Croatia’s senior national team and scored one goal, confirming his status as one of the country’s most promising young talents.
He also made his World Cup debut against England in the group stage, gaining valuable experience at the highest level. 🌍🔥
His move to the Premier League represents a major step in his career, especially with the competition level and world-class attackers in English football.
